Kennesaw man charged with child cruelty

Dec. 23—A Kennesaw man was arrested and charged with two felonies, cruelty to children and aggravated battery, after police say his infant daughter was injured in his care, according to a warrant.

Hitesh Patel, 40, was charged last week by the Acworth Police Department for the incident, which occurred on the afternoon of Nov. 1. According to the warrant, Patel was left to take care of his three-month-old daughter while his wife left for 20-30 minutes. The baby was unhurt when the wife left.

When the wife returned, the baby was "cold to the touch, temperature was low, with her eyes and tongue rolled back," the warrant says.
